Composer: CASSADÓ, Gaspar ((1897-1966))
CASSADÓ, Gaspar His/her music:
Basically wrote for the cello. Character pieces and a solo suite as well as two sonatas for cello and piano. He realized many transcriptions of other composers. Also a few piano pieces and a violin sonata. Premiered many new works.

His/her life:
Gaspar Cassadó was born in Barcelona on the 30th of September 1897, and it was in that city where he began to study music at the early age of 5. In 1907 he moved to Paris with his father, the musician Joaquim Cassadó. In Paris he met and studied with Pablo Casals. He there studied harmony with Ravel and De Falla. His studies with Casals had a profound effect on him both technically and musically, that marked the rest of his life.
